Medical cost has grown more than inflation for the past 20 years - and it's not getting better!
We have to do all we can to save on medical cost - even if it appears to be a small savings.
Here's a few ideas:
- Ask your doctor for generic prescriptions.
- Give up a bad habit such as smoking or alcohol. A pack-a-day smoker will save over $1000 in a year!
- Have regular checkups.
- Use clinics or the local health department when possible.
- Ask your doctor for sample prescriptions. Most doctors have samples, especially for new products.
